When it comes to a hotel, there are always hotel chains you are familiar with including Hilton and Marriott among others, but if you are looking for something different, traditional and unique while visiting Kyoto, check out this Kyoto Machiya hotel. Paolo takes us on a tour of this 100-year-old hotel. From the facade to interior, the historic architecture offers quintessential Japanese experience.
